How much do Airbnb hosts make on average per month in Sandnes?

The short-term rental market in Sandnes shows distinct revenue patterns across different property tiers. Our analysis reveals that successful properties combine strategic pricing with quality management to maximize earnings potential. Market data demonstrates clear revenue differentiation among properties:

  • Typical properties (median) earn $1,381 per month
  • Strong performing properties (top 25%) make $2,356 or more
  • Best-in-class properties (top 10%) achieve $3,875+ monthly
  • Entry-level properties (bottom 25%) typically earn around $660

Occupancy Rates Throughout the Year in Sandnes

The market in Sandnes shows distinct occupancy patterns influenced by seasonal trends and local dynamics. Properties that maintain high guest satisfaction scores and implement strategic pricing consistently achieve stronger occupancy rates. Current market data shows:

  • Typical properties (median) maintain 37% occupancy rates
  • Strong performing properties (top 25%) achieve 61% or higher
  • Best-in-class properties (top 10%) reach 83%+occupancy
  • Entry-level properties (bottom 25%) average around 17%

Average Daily Rates Seasonal Trends in Sandnes

Daily rates in Sandnes vary based on seasonality, property quality, and market dynamics. Properties that effectively balance competitive pricing with strong amenities typically command higher rates. Market analysis shows the following rate structure:

  • Typical properties (median) generate $115 per night
  • Strong performing properties (top 25%) secure $178 or more
  • Best-in-class properties (top 10%) pull in $257+ per night
  • Entry-level properties (bottom 25%) earn around $75

Seasonality patterns in Sandnes

Peak Season (August, July, June)
  • Revenue peaks at $2649.65 per month
  • Occupancy rates reach 58.04%
  • Daily rates average $157.21
Shoulder Season
  • Revenue averages $1895.87 per month
  • Occupancy maintains 40.85%
  • Daily rates hold at $142.44
Low Season (November, December, January)
  • Revenue drops to $1089.98 per month
  • Occupancy decreases to 31.32%
  • Daily rates adjust to $128.49

Room Capacity Distribution

Analysis of 221 properties in Sandnes shows that 2 bedrooms properties are most prevalent, making up 26.7% of the market. The market tends to favor smaller properties, with 2 bedrooms and 1 bedroom together representing 50.2% of all listings.

Key Insights

  • Most common: 2 bedrooms (26.7%)
  • Least common: 5+ bedrooms (5.4%)
  • Market concentration: 50.2% in top 2 sizes
  • Market skew: Favors smaller properties

Guest Capacity Distribution

Analysis of 221 properties in Sandnes reveals that 4 guests properties dominate the market, representing 19.5% of all listings. The average property accommodates 4.6 guests, with a clear trend towards larger guest capacities. Properties accommodating 4 guests and 8+ guests make up 37.6% of the market.

Key Insights

  • Most common capacity: 4 guests (19.5% of market)
  • Least common capacity: 1 guest (0.9% of market)
  • Average guest capacity: 4.6 guests per property
  • Market concentration: 37.6% in top 2 capacity sizes
  • Market segmentation: Predominantly larger guest capacities

Booking Lead Time Trends

Key Insights

  • Peak booking lead times occur in May, Jul, Jun, averaging 86 days
  • Shortest booking windows are in Oct, Nov, Feb, averaging 39 days
  • Summer shows the longest average booking window at 73 days, while Winter has the shortest at 42 days

Recommendations

  • Implement dynamic pricing strategies for Summer bookings at least 73 days in advance
  • Consider early bird discounts during Winter to encourage longer lead times
  • Focus on last-minute booking promotions during Oct-Feb when lead times are shortest
